WebMay 28, 2024 · To change the nice value for a running process you must use sudo . Note that there is no “-” on the 5 parameter. You don’t need one for positive numbers and you only need one, not two, for negative numbers. sudo renice -n 5 2339. We get confirmation that renice has changed the nice value.

Installing antivirus software on an RD Session Host server greatly affects overall system performance, especially CPU usage. We highly recommend that you exclude from the active monitoring list all the folders that hold temporary files, especially those that services and other system components generate.
